The invention relates to the technical field of automobile parts, in particular to the technical field of deoiling devices.
[ background of the invention ]
Many components such as nuts, bolts, washers, etc. are used in automobiles. These products sometimes require de-oiling during the manufacturing process. Because the grease of the parts on the parts is firmly adhered, the deoiling effect of the existing deoiling equipment is not ideal.
[ summary of the invention ]
The invention aims to solve the problems in the prior art and provides an automobile part deoiling device which can effectively deoil a workpiece and has a good deoiling effect.
In order to achieve the purpose, the invention provides an automobile part deoiling device which comprises a box body, a material containing barrel, a central pipe, a sealing cover, a hot blowing pipe, an air suction pipe and a power device, wherein the upper end of the box body is opened, the upper end of the box body is covered with the sealing cover, the sealing cover is fixedly provided with the hot blowing pipe penetrating through the sealing cover, the hot blowing pipe is connected with a hot blower positioned outside the box body, the material containing barrel is arranged in the box body and is cylindrical, the material containing barrel consists of a lower plate body, a barrel body and an upper plate body, the lower plate body is connected with the upper plate body through the barrel body, the central pipe coaxial with the material containing barrel is arranged in the material containing barrel, the upper end and the lower end of the central pipe are respectively fixed on the upper plate body and the lower half body, the side wall of the barrel body is provided with a plurality of first through holes, the side wall of, the bearing sleeve is arranged outside the hot blowing pipe, the hot blowing pipe extends into the central pipe, the bottom of the lower plate body is connected with a rotating shaft, the rotating shaft is connected with a power device positioned outside the box body, the side wall of the box body is connected with an air suction pipe, and the air suction pipe is connected with an air suction fan positioned outside the box body.
Preferably, the bottom of the box body is provided with an oil collecting groove which is sunken downwards, and the bottom of the oil collecting groove is connected with an oil outlet pipe with a valve.
Preferably, the air outlet end of the suction fan is connected with an oil-gas separator.
Preferably, a plurality of oil guide grooves radiating outwards from the central pipe are arranged on the upper end face of the lower plate body, the oil guide grooves are opened on the side wall of the lower plate body, and the oil guide grooves incline outwards and downwards from the side close to the central pipe.
Preferably, the upper plate body is provided with a feeding and discharging door capable of being opened and closed.
Preferably, the diameter of the second through hole on the central tube is gradually reduced from top to bottom, and the distance between the second through hole positioned at the top and the top end of the central tube is 1/4-1/3 of the height of the central tube.
The invention has the beneficial effects that: according to the invention, the hot blast pipe is matched with the central pipe, so that grease on automobile parts is softened, and the deoiling effect is improved; the setting of leading the oil groove makes the automobile parts who is located the bottom and the contact surface between the lower plate body diminish, and the deoiling of being convenient for also makes the difficult long-pending oil of flourishing feed cylinder bottom simultaneously, has guaranteed the deoiling effect.

FIG. 1 is a front view of an oil removing device for automobile parts according to the present invention.
In the figure: 1-box body, 2-material containing barrel, 3-upper plate body, 4-lower plate body, 5-barrel body, 6-central tube, 10-sealing cover, 11-hot air blowing pipe, 12-hot air blower, 13-oil collecting tank, 14-oil outlet pipe, 15-air suction pipe, 16-air suction fan, 17-oil-gas separator, 20-rotating shaft, 21-power device, 30-feeding and discharging door, 31-bearing, 40-oil guiding groove, 50-first through hole and 60-second through hole.
[ detailed description ] embodiments
Referring to fig. 1, the invention relates to an automobile part deoiling device, which comprises a box body 1, a material containing barrel 2, a central pipe 6, a sealing cover 10, a hot blowing pipe 11, an air suction pipe 15 and a power device 21, wherein the upper end of the box body 1 is opened, the upper end of the box body 1 is covered with the sealing cover 10, the sealing cover 10 is fixed with the hot blowing pipe 11 penetrating through the sealing cover 10, the hot blowing pipe 11 is connected with a hot blower 12 positioned outside the box body 1, the material containing barrel 2 is arranged in the box body 1, the material containing barrel 2 is cylindrical, the material containing barrel 2 consists of a lower plate body 4, a barrel body 5 and an upper plate body 3, the lower plate body 4 is connected with the upper plate body 3 through the barrel body 5, the material containing barrel 2 is internally provided with the central pipe 6 which is coaxial with the material containing barrel 2, the upper end and the lower end of the central pipe 6 are respectively fixed on, the side wall of the central tube 6 is provided with a plurality of second through holes 60, the center of the upper plate body 3 is provided with a bearing 31 matched with the hot blast pipe 11, the bearing 31 is sleeved outside the hot blast pipe 11, the hot blast pipe 11 extends into the central tube 6, the bottom of the lower plate body 4 is connected with a rotating shaft 20, the rotating shaft 20 is connected with a power device 21 positioned outside the box body 1, the side wall of the box body 1 is connected with an air suction pipe 15, the air suction pipe 15 is connected with an air suction fan 16 positioned outside the box body 1, the bottom of the box body 1 is provided with a downward sunken oil collecting tank 13, the bottom of the oil collecting tank 13 is connected with an oil outlet pipe 14 with a valve, the air outlet end of the air suction fan 16 is connected with an oil-gas separator 17, the upper end face of the lower plate body 4 is provided with a plurality of oil guide grooves 40 radiating outwards from the central tube 6, and the oil guide, the oil guide groove 40 inclines downwards from the side close to the central tube 6 to the outside, the upper plate body 3 is provided with a feeding and discharging door 30 which can be opened and closed, the diameter of the second through hole 60 on the central tube 6 is gradually reduced from the top to the bottom, and the distance between the second through hole 60 at the top and the top end of the central tube 6 is 1/4-1/3 of the height of the central tube 6.
The working process of the invention is as follows:
in the working process of the deoiling device for the automobile parts, the hot blast pipe 11 is matched with the central pipe 6, so that grease on the automobile parts is softened, and the deoiling effect is improved; the arrangement of the oil guide groove 40 enables the contact surface between the automobile parts positioned at the bottom and the lower plate body 4 to be small, so that oil can be removed conveniently, oil is not easy to accumulate at the bottom of the material containing cylinder 2, and the oil removing effect is ensured.
